A month-long celebration of art, history, and culture with our Voices of Venus Art Exhibition! This unique exhibition showcases the works of all-female local artists—Ellen Fairchild-Flugel, Rachel Fitzsimmons, and Shawna Marsh. Each artist brings her own perspective to the theme of feminine artistic concepts and abstract expressions, with a special focus on historical imagery. The exhibition includes evocative photographs from the Civil War era, stunning depictions of various dagger types, and powerful portraits of the pioneering women of the Shenandoah Valley.

This event will run for the entire month, except for Mondays, when we’ll be closed (17th, 24th, and 31st).

Join Virginia Women in Wine for an inspiring evening with Janel Laravie, a trailblazer who turned bold ideas into thriving businesses. Originally from West Virginia, Janel built a successful career in digital advertising before taking a leap of faith in 2009 to launch Chacka Marketing, a nationally recognized agency and three-time INC 5000 honoree. But her entrepreneurial spirit didn’t stop there.
In 2021, Janel and her husband purchased Wolf Gap Vineyard in Edinburg, VA, bringing her vision and business acumen to Virginia’s wine industry. In just three years, they quadrupled production and earned the title of #1 Winery Tour by Newsweek Magazine. Today, Janel balances life as a Mom, Wine Producer, and CEO, proving that passion and strategy can transform industries.
Join us as Janel shares her remarkable journey, her 4 favorite wines, the challenges and triumphs of entrepreneurship and motherhood, and how she’s making an impact in Virginia wine.
